Anthony Hopkins to Play Evil Sorcerer in Arabian Nights

Sir_Anthony_HopkinsAnthony Hopkins is going from playing the Norse God Odin in Thor to an evil sorcerer in Chuck Russell’s (The Scorpion King) latest film, Arabian Nights, according to The Hollywood Reporter’s Heat Vision blog.

Hopkins will be working with Liam Hemsworth on Arabian Nights, after working with Liam’s brother Chris, who plays the title character in Thor.  Liam will be starring as a young commander who joins forces with Sinbad, Ali Baba and the Genie of the Lamp to rescue queen Scheherazade. Hopkins character, Pharotu, is a sorcerer who has murdered the king as well as Hemsworth’s mermaid love and is trying to amass more magic to rule the kingdom.

Chuck Russell is directing from a screenplay he wrote alongside Barry P Ambrose. The film goes before cameras at the end of the summer. In the meantime, Hopkins will be starring as a rebel exorcist in the film The Rite with Ciarán Hinds (There Will be Blood, In Bruges), Alice Braga (the upcoming Predators film), Toby Jones (Infamous, Friost/Nixon) & Colin O’Donoghue (the Tudors).
